Core Insights - The Kuwait Environmental Remediation Program's oil lake crude oil recovery project, involving China's Jereh Group, has successfully completed the operation test of its first set of equipment, marking the official implementation phase of the project [1] - The project aims to address the oil pollution and war-related issues caused by the Gulf War, with Jereh Group providing the overall solution and core equipment, amounting to approximately 100 million RMB [1] - Jereh Group's involvement demonstrates the strength of Chinese manufacturing and service capabilities in the oil and gas industry and environmental protection [1] Company and Industry Summary - Jereh Group's Middle East President highlighted the company's active participation in Kuwait's oil and gas industry and environmental initiatives, showcasing the comprehensive strength of Chinese manufacturing and services [1] - The Chinese Embassy in Kuwait emphasized that Jereh Group's successful implementation contributes to environmental remediation in Kuwait and reflects the international competitiveness of Chinese environmental equipment and engineering technology [1] - The Gulf War in the 1990s resulted in severe environmental damage in Kuwait, with hundreds of oil wells ignited, leading to significant oil spills and pollution issues [1]
